1988 BMW 520 vs. 1982 Skoda L

To start off, 1988 BMW 520 is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1982 Skoda L.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1982 Skoda L would be higher. At 1,989 cc (6 cylinders), 1988 BMW 520 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1988 BMW 520 (129 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 85 more horse power than 1982 Skoda L. (44 HP @ 4800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1988 BMW 520 should accelerate faster than 1982 Skoda L.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1988 BMW 520 weights approximately 745 kg more than 1982 Skoda L.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1988 BMW 520 (174 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 100 more torque (in Nm) than 1982 Skoda L. (74 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1988 BMW 520 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1982 Skoda L.

Compare all specifications:

1988 BMW 520 1982 Skoda L
Make BMW Skoda
Model 520 L
Year Released 1988 1982
Engine Position Front Rear
Engine Size 1989 cc 1046 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 129 HP 44 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 4800 RPM
Torque 174 Nm 74 Nm
Torque RPM 4000 RPM 3000 RPM
Engine Bore Size 80 mm 68.1 mm
Engine Stroke Size 66 mm 72 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 10.5:1 8.5:1
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1570 kg 825 kg
Vehicle Length 4780 mm 4170 mm
Vehicle Width 1810 mm 1600 mm
Vehicle Height 1440 mm 1410 mm
Wheelbase Size 2770 mm 2410 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 70 L 38 L
